Galvanistraat 93 – Duinoord, The Hague Spacious and characterful 5-room ground floor apartment with rear extension and a large private garden, ideally located on a quiet street in the highly desirable Duinoord district. After being lovingly occupied by the same resident for more than half a century, this remarkable ground floor apartment is now available. The property exudes history and authenticity, with numerous original details reflecting the grandeur of early 20th-century architecture. At the same time, it offers a rare opportunity: with a thorough renovation, this house can be transformed into a contemporary and comfortable home, fully tailored to your own style and preferences. With approx. 128 m² of living space, soaring ceilings, generous rooms, and a beautiful garden of approx. 100 m², this apartment ranks among the most appealing properties in Duinoord. The possibilities are endless – whether you envision a stylish family home, a spacious city residence with a home office, or a combination of living and working. Layout and character Upon entering, the home’s classic charm is immediately apparent: a vestibule, high ornamental ceilings, paneled doors, wall paneling, and an authentic staircase set the tone. The living/dining room ensuite spans nearly 4 meters in width and more than 12 meters in depth, with an impressive ceiling height of 3.30 meters. Large windows and French doors create a bright, airy feel and direct access to the garden. The rear extension houses three generously sized bedrooms, all with views and access to the garden. This creates a peaceful sleeping environment, ideal for those who enjoy quiet and greenery. The flexible floor plan allows for easy reconfiguration – for example, by relocating the kitchen to the dining room, a fourth bedroom or spacious study could be added. The garden – a rare city oasis The rear garden of approx. 100 m² is a true highlight. With its favorable northwest orientation, it enjoys sunlight throughout the day. Its generous size makes it suitable for multiple terraces, a play area, or even an outdoor kitchen. A rare, private oasis in the heart of the city. Location – stately yet lively Galvanistraat lies in the heart of Duinoord, one of The Hague’s most sought-after neighborhoods. Known for its monumental buildings, wide avenues, and charming residential streets, the area offers a unique mix of tranquility and vibrancy. The popular Reinkenstraat with its boutique shops and restaurants is just around the corner. The city center, Scheveningen beach, the International Zone, and several (international) schools are all within easy reach. Excellent public transport connections and nearby access to major roads make the location highly convenient. Key features Unique opportunity to renovate and create your dream home; Authentic period details including high ceilings and paneled doors; Spacious living/dining room ensuite (approx. 3.93 m wide x 12.63 m deep); 3 bedrooms with potential for a 4th; Living area approx. 128 m² (NEN measured); Large private garden of approx. 100 m², northwest-facing; Energy label G; Freehold property (no ground lease); Active homeowners’ association, monthly contribution €100; Building inspection report available; Transfer by mutual agreement.
